About this ebook

This book can be used as a weekly support group guide with a facilitator. By going through each step weekly and sharing your experiences and thoughts that you deem valuable, you will be able to interact with others and reflect on your shared addictions and journeys. This material is easy reading for all adults. This journey will be an awakening to Gods compassion and grace.

By combining the twelve steps with scriptures, this book will help you to heal from damaged emotions and continue to work on your recovery with support and encouragement from others who are journaling along with you. This book will provide you with an opportunity to develop balance and to establish a renewed relationship with God.

Author

Jewel Harper

Jewel Harper, BA, MPA, MDiv, is a graduate of the University of California, Berkeley; the University of Southern California; and Fuller Theological Seminary in Pasadena, California. She is a chaplain at a Substance Abuse Rehabilitation Center in Dallas Texas. Jewel continues to have a passion for those who are hurting. Most of her life she has been involved in public service which includes the following areas: hospice care, urban ministries, bereavement support groups, and youth mentoring and big brothers and sisters programs. These are just a sample of her desire and love for others and the community. She continues to speak and teach about spirituality in addiction she is also a member of The McKinney 1st Baptist Church, Delta Sigma Theta, and Association of Christian Counselors. She enjoys traveling the globe; Jewel resides in Texas and California

    INTRODUCTION

    My Sanctuary is a personal guide to understanding the twelve-step

    program and how it can be integrated biblically with a Christian perspective. I believe that scripture and the twelve steps are both important healing tools and that if you apply these tools to your life, you can open yourself to God’s grace, mercy, and unconditional love. The main theme of My Sanctuary is that healing is possible. Everyone can experience a sanctuary in which wounds can heal.

    Why a spiritual recovery journal? It is a record of your addiction

    and those experiences and thoughts you deem valuable. Within the journal you will be able to preserve those interactions, events, and reflections that trace your personal history with God. This material is for adults who have experienced feelings of guilt and shame, low self-esteem, low self-worth, anxiety, and unworthiness. It is also for those who have been hiding their addictions and are fearful of allowing them to come out in the open.

    This journal will help you replace addictive behaviors with spiritual strength.

    This journey will be an awakening to God’s compassion and His grace. The twelve steps and accompanying scripture passages help you rediscover and deepen your spiritual life
